Key Features

  • Slim design saves mounting space.
  • Simple front-side wiring with Push-In Plus terminal blocks for quick installation.
  • Intuitive LED indicators for fast and accurate troubleshooting.
  • Two instantaneous safety outputs (DPST-NO) and two OFF-delayed safety outputs (DPST-NO).
  • OFF-delay time configurable in 16 steps from 0 to 5 seconds.
  • Achieves up to PLe according to EN ISO 13849-1 and SIL 3 according to EN 61508.
  • Certified for lift standards EN 81-1 and EN 81-2.

Safe OFF delay function up to PLe.

Industrial Applications

1. Machine Guard Door Monitoring with Delayed Access

Used to monitor a safety interlock switch on a machine guard door. When the door is opened, the instantaneous safety outputs immediately cut power to hazardous motion (e.g., a spindle), while the off-delay outputs keep a solenoid lock engaged for a preset time until the machine has fully stopped, preventing premature access.

Problem Solved

Ensures that operators cannot access a hazardous area until the machine has reached a safe state, even after the guard door is opened. The adjustable off-delay (up to 5s) allows tuning for different machine coast-down times.

2. Emergency Stop for Conveyor Systems with Sequential Shutdown

Integrated into a conveyor line's emergency stop circuit. When an E-stop button is pressed, the instantaneous outputs halt the main conveyor drive. The off-delay output allows an upstream feeder conveyor to continue running for a few seconds, clearing product and preventing jams during the emergency stop event.

Problem Solved

Provides a safe and orderly shutdown of a multi-stage process, preventing material jams and equipment damage that can be caused by an abrupt, simultaneous stop of all components. The 24VDC supply and fast 15ms response are ideal for typical control circuits.

3. Light Curtain Protection for Robotic Cells with Power-On Delay

Connects to the OSSD outputs of a safety light curtain guarding a robotic work cell. If an operator breaches the curtain, the instantaneous outputs stop the robot immediately. The off-delay feature can be used in reverse logic; upon clearing the area and resetting, the delay timer can stagger the startup of different cell components, ensuring a safe and controlled restart sequence.

Problem Solved

Provides immediate hazardous motion stop upon intrusion while enabling a controlled, staggered power-up sequence upon reset, preventing high inrush currents or unsafe initial machine states. The IP20 rating and slim profile are suitable for typical control cabinet installations.
